Name

    ANGLE_platform_angle_vulkan

Name Strings

    EGL_ANGLE_platform_angle_vulkan

Contributors

    Jamie Madill, Google

Contacts

    Jamie Madill, Google (jmadill 'at' google 'dot' com)

Status

    Draft

Version

    Version 2, 2017-07-19

Number

    EGL Extension XXX

Extension Type

    EGL client extension

Dependencies

    Requires ANGLE_platform_angle.

Overview

    This extension enables selection of Vulkan display types.

New Types

    None

New Procedures and Functions

    None

New Tokens

    Accepted as values for the EGL_PLATFORM_ANGLE_TYPE_ANGLE attribute:

        EGL_PLATFORM_ANGLE_TYPE_VULKAN_ANGLE               0x3450

Additions to the EGL Specification

    None.

New Behavior

    To request a display that is backed by a Vulkan driver, the value of
    EGL_PLATFORM_ANGLE_TYPE_ANGLE should be
    EGL_PLATFORM_ANGLE_TYPE_VULKAN_ANGLE.

    If EGL_PLATFORM_ANGLE_MAX_VERSION_MAJOR_ANGLE and
    EGL_PLATFORM_ANGLE_MAX_VERSION_MINOR_ANGLE are not specified, the
    implementation will decide which version of Vulkan to instantiate. If they
    are specified, it will choose a version that is lower or equal to the
    specified major and minor versions. The only current values accepted for
    major and minor version are 1 for major and 0 for minor.

Issues

    1) Should ANGLE always instantiate the highest available version of Vulkan?

       RESOLVED: It's possible that in a future implementation of Vulkan there
       may be driver issues present only on some version of Vulkan, and there's
       no explicit guarantee higher versions will be more stable. Hence, we should
       give ANGLE some flexiblity in this regard and leave this unspecified.
